Review by ZX KNIGHT on 23 Mar 2012 (Rating: 3)

Christmas Cracker was a Eurogamer exclusive title by modern homebrew legend Jonathan Cauldwell, featuring his not-at-all Dizzy-like character, Egghead.

The game is a cute nod to magazine tie-in games of the past such as Moley Christmas (reviewed below) as you have to rescue the staff of Eurogamer who have become snowed in for Christmas.

While the game has the usual high quality of a Cauldwell game there is a slight knock-out rushed feel to it. Like Crimbo it doesn't have a right load of screens but unlike Crimbo it doesn't offer much by way of difficulty, and you shouldn't really have any problems completing this game within twenty minutes unless you lack hands.

That said, the point of the game wasn't really to provide a stern challenge to gamers, but to provide readers of Eurogamer a nice little treat for Christmas and encourage them to perhaps try out some more retro games, particularly ones by Jonathan Cauldwell.

On that level, Christmas Cracker succeeds, and it's certainly worth a quick, enjoyable playthrough. But it's unlikely to be something you'll seek out more than once. However there are many other adventures involving Egghead if you enjoy playing the game, which I suspect you might.
